{"title":"Desiccant Air Dryers","description":"\u003ch5\u003eDesiccant air dryers for exceptionally dry compressed air down to −40 °C\u003c\/h5\u003e\u003cp\u003e\u003cstrong\u003eDesiccant air dryers\u003c\/strong\u003e are used when a significantly lower pressure dew point is required than with conventional refrigerated air dryers. The current product line achieves pressure dew points as low as \u003cstrong\u003e−40 °C\u003c\/strong\u003e, making it suitable for demanding industrial processes, instrument air, and applications where moisture must be consistently and thoroughly reduced.\u003c\/p\u003e\u003cp\u003eThe selection includes modular units ranging from \u003cstrong\u003e0.5 to 1.5 m³\/min\u003c\/strong\u003e at a maximum of 16 bar\u003cstrong\u003e,\u003c\/strong\u003e as well as larger systems ranging from 2\u003cstrong\u003e to 25 m³\/min\u003c\/strong\u003e at a maximum of 10 bar. Models with fixed cycle times and variants with pressure dew point control are available. All current systems are equipped with pre- and post-filters.\u003c\/p\u003e\u003cdiv style=\"background:#f5f5f5;border-radius:10px;padding:18px;margin:22px 0;\"\u003e\n\u003ch5\u003eSelecting the Right Desiccant Air Dryer\u003c\/h5\u003e\n\u003cp style=\"margin:0;\"\u003e✅ 0.5 to 1.5 m³\/min – modular systems up to 16 bar\u003c\/p\u003e\n\u003cp style=\"margin:0;\"\u003e✅ 2 to 25 m³\/min – larger systems up to 10 bar\u003c\/p\u003e\n\u003cp style=\"margin:0;\"\u003e✅ Pressure dew point down to −40 °C\u003c\/p\u003e\n\u003cp style=\"margin:0;\"\u003e✅ Fixed cycle times for defined operational processes\u003c\/p\u003e\n\u003cp style=\"margin:0;\"\u003e✅ Pressure dew point control for demand-based regeneration\u003c\/p\u003e\n\u003cp style=\"margin:0;\"\u003e✅ Pre-filters and post-filters included in the current product range\u003c\/p\u003e\n\u003c\/div\u003e","products":[{"product_id":"comprag-adsorptionstrockner-adx-f-feste-zykluszeiten-taupunkt-bis-max-40-c-mit-vor-und-nachfilter-2-bis-25-m-min","title":"ADX-F desiccant air dryer with fixed cycle times, pressure dew point down to -40 °C, 10 bar, with pre- and post-filters, 2–25 m³\/min","description":"\u003ch5\u003e\u003cstrong\u003eComprag ADX-F – Rugged desiccant air dryer with a fixed 10-minute cycle\u003c\/strong\u003e\u003c\/h5\u003e\n\u003cp\u003eComprag’s ADX-F series desiccant air dryers are designed for reliable drying in demanding compressed air systems. They permanently reduce humidity to a pressure dew point of up to –40°C, thereby reliably protecting machinery, control systems, and processes from condensation and corrosion. With a fixed 10-minute cycle, the units operate stably, require minimal maintenance, and are highly efficient. The low purge air volume of only about 1 % ensures low operating costs—ideal for industrial and trade applications.\u003c\/p\u003e\n\u003chr\u003e\n\u003ch5\u003e✅ Questions\u003c\/h5\u003e\n\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eWhat does “fixed cycle” mean?\u003c\/strong\u003e\u003cbr\u003eThe dryer operates in a cycle that is always 10 minutes long (8 minutes of drying, 2 minutes of regeneration), regardless of the load.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eWhat is the purge air consumption?\u003c\/strong\u003e\u003cbr\u003eThanks to optimized cycle control, this amounts to only about 1 % of the volume of dried air.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eIs an external control system required?\u003c\/strong\u003e\u003cbr\u003eNo—the ADX-F operates fully automatically and comes ready to connect.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eHow often do filter elements and desiccants need to be replaced?\u003c\/strong\u003e\u003cbr\u003eRecommended replacement interval for filter elements: annually. Desiccant depending on operating hours—approximately every 3 to 5 years.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eCan the dryer be integrated into existing systems?\u003c\/strong\u003e\u003cbr\u003eYes—thanks to standardized connections and a compact design, installation is straightforward.\u003c\/li\u003e\n\u003c\/ul\u003e","brand":"Comprag","offers":[{"title":"2.00","offer_id":49184012861787,"sku":"14400201","price":2509.01,"currency_code":"EUR","in_stock":true},{"title":"3.00","offer_id":49184012894555,"sku":"14400202","price":2633.98,"currency_code":"EUR","in_stock":true},{"title":"4.00","offer_id":49184012927323,"sku":"14400203","price":3390.18,"currency_code":"EUR","in_stock":true},{"title":"5.00","offer_id":49184012960091,"sku":"14400204","price":3493.97,"currency_code":"EUR","in_stock":true},{"title":"7.00","offer_id":49184047694171,"sku":"14400205","price":3875.25,"currency_code":"EUR","in_stock":true},{"title":"9.00","offer_id":49184047726939,"sku":"14400206","price":4053.18,"currency_code":"EUR","in_stock":true},{"title":"12.50","offer_id":49184047759707,"sku":"14400207","price":6245.51,"currency_code":"EUR","in_stock":true},{"title":"16.00","offer_id":49184047792475,"sku":"14400208","price":6611.96,"currency_code":"EUR","in_stock":true},{"title":"20.00","offer_id":49184047825243,"sku":"14400209","price":7603.28,"currency_code":"EUR","in_stock":true},{"title":"25.00","offer_id":49184047858011,"sku":"14400210","price":8061.87,"currency_code":"EUR","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0876\/8526\/7803\/files\/adsorptionstrockner-adx-f-comprag.jpg?v=1728400456"},{"product_id":"comprag-adsorptionstrockner-adx-f-pdp-mit-drucktaupunktsteuerung-taupunkt-bis-max-40-c-10-bar-mit-vor-und-nachfilter-2-bis-25-m-min","title":"ADX-F-PDP desiccant air dryer with pressure dew point control, pressure dew point down to -40 °C, 10 bar, with pre- and post-filters, 2–25 m³\/min","description":"\u003ch5\u003e\u003cstrong\u003eComprag ADX-F-PDP – Intelligent desiccant air dryer with pressure dew point control\u003c\/strong\u003e\u003c\/h5\u003e\n\u003cp\u003eComprag’s ADX-F-PDP series desiccant air dryers are equipped with state-of-the-art pressure dew point control (PDP). Questions\u003c\/h5\u003e\n\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eHow does the PDP control system work?\u003c\/strong\u003e\u003cbr\u003eA sensor measures the dew point and dynamically adjusts the adsorption time. Regeneration remains constant—ensuring that only the necessary purge air is consumed.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eHow much do I save with the control system?\u003c\/strong\u003e\u003cbr\u003eUp to 40% lower purge air consumption compared to fixed cycles—often pays for itself in less than 6 months.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eDo I need to configure anything?\u003c\/strong\u003e\u003cbr\u003eNo—the PDP controller is factory-preset but can be flexibly adjusted via the LCD display.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eHow often do the filters need to be replaced?\u003c\/strong\u003e\u003cbr\u003ePre-filters and post-filters should be replaced once a year or as needed, depending on the level of contamination.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eCan the dryer be integrated into existing systems?\u003c\/strong\u003e\u003cbr\u003eYes—thanks to standard connections and its compact design, the ADX-F-PDP is ready to connect.\u003c\/li\u003e\n\u003c\/ul\u003e","brand":"Comprag","offers":[{"title":"2.00","offer_id":49184099238235,"sku":"14400301","price":3398.65,"currency_code":"EUR","in_stock":true},{"title":"3.00","offer_id":49184099271003,"sku":"14400302","price":3524.68,"currency_code":"EUR","in_stock":true},{"title":"4.00","offer_id":49184099303771,"sku":"14400303","price":4279.82,"currency_code":"EUR","in_stock":true},{"title":"5.00","offer_id":49184099336539,"sku":"14400304","price":4383.61,"currency_code":"EUR","in_stock":true},{"title":"7.00","offer_id":49184099369307,"sku":"14400305","price":4765.95,"currency_code":"EUR","in_stock":true},{"title":"9.00","offer_id":49184099402075,"sku":"14400306","price":4942.82,"currency_code":"EUR","in_stock":true},{"title":"12.50","offer_id":49184099434843,"sku":"14400307","price":7135.16,"currency_code":"EUR","in_stock":true},{"title":"16.00","offer_id":49184099467611,"sku":"14400308","price":7501.61,"currency_code":"EUR","in_stock":true},{"title":"20.00","offer_id":49184099500379,"sku":"14400309","price":8493.98,"currency_code":"EUR","in_stock":true},{"title":"25.00","offer_id":49184099533147,"sku":"14400310","price":8951.51,"currency_code":"EUR","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0876\/8526\/7803\/files\/adsorptionstrockner-adx-f-pdp-comprag.jpg?v=1728401214"},{"product_id":"comprag-modulare-adsorptionstrockner-adm-mit-festen-zykluszeiten-taupunkt-bis-max-40-c-16-bar-mit-vor-und-nachfilter-0-5-bis-1-5-m-min","title":"ADM modular desiccant air dryers with fixed cycle times, dew point down to max. -40 °C, 16 bar, with pre- and post-filters, 0.5–1.5 m³\/min","description":"\u003ch5\u003e\u003cstrong\u003eComprag ADM – Compact fixed-cycle desiccant air dryer\u003c\/strong\u003e\u003c\/h5\u003e\n\u003cp\u003eThe Comprag ADM series desiccant air dryers with fixed cycle times are the ideal solution for applications with a constant demand for compressed air.
